
MARSHALL, Minn. - Southwest Minnesota State University head football coach Cory Sauter announced today the signing of 33 high school and junior college student-athletes to National Letters of Intent to continue their academic and football careers at SMSU. That announcement came today on the first day student-athletes are allowed to sign National Letters of Intent. The one junior college transfer has already enrolled at SMSU for 2012 spring semester.
The list includes student-athletes from 10 different states including Minnesota (17), Iowa (6), Illinois (2), Colorado (2), South Dakota (2), Wisconsin (1), Texas (1), Indiana (1) and California (1). The list of signees includes six offensive lineman, six defensive lineman, six wide receivers, six defensive backs, six linebackers, one running back, one fullback, one tight end and one kicker/punter.
"Today is another special day for Mustang football," Sauter said on Wednesday. "There are 33 student-athletes who have made a huge commitment to Southwest Minnesota State University. This is an important recruiting class because they will be part of the foundation that this program is built upon. Our entire coaching staff has worked extremely hard over the past year to attract the best student-athletes to SMSU. This recruiting class has several players who will be able to compete for playing time in the near future. I can't wait to see this group unite with our returners to become an improved team in 2012 and beyond."
Sauter also stated the program is expected to announce more signings in the next week or later this spring.
Southwest Minnesota State is an NCAA Division II school located in Marshall, Minn., and competes in the Northern Sun Intercollegiate Conference. SMSU finished with an overall record of 3-8 in 2011, including a 3-7 mark in conference play finishing in 11th place in the 14-team conference.
SMSU is scheduled to begin spring practice on March 26. The Mustangs will open the 2012 season on Saturday, Sept. 1, with a conference home game versus the University of Minnesota Duluth.
